Understanding the MLB World Series Start Date
The question "When Does The Mlb World Series Start ?" signifies the culmination of an entire Major League Baseball season. It's the championship series where the American League and National League pennant winners battle for the Commissioner's Trophy. For the 2025 MLB season, the World Series typically begins in late October, following the conclusion of the League Championship Series. The exact start date is usually announced by MLB well in advance, allowing fans, teams, and media to prepare. Comparing World Series Ticket Options and Pricing Tiers
Securing tickets for the MLB World Series requires understanding the various seating categories and pricing tiers available. For the 2025 season, ticket prices will fluctuate based on factors such as the participating teams, the specific game (e.g., Game 1 vs. a potential Game 7), and the seating location within the ballpark. Generally, tickets are categorized into several tiers:
| Seating Category | Description | Estimated 2025 Pricing Range (per ticket) |
|---|---|---|
| Premium Suites/Club Seats | Includes exclusive access, catered food and beverages, and prime field views. Often the most expensive option. | $1,000 - $5,000+ |
| Infield Box Seats | Excellent views of the action, typically located between the bases. High demand and price. | $400 - $1,200 |
| Outfield Reserved Seats | Good views of the game, located in the outfield sections. More affordable than infield seats. | $150 - $400 |
| Upper Deck/General Admission | More budget-friendly options, offering a bird's-eye view of the entire field. | $75 - $200 |
It's important to note that these are estimated ranges and actual prices for the 2025 World Series can vary significantly. Dynamic pricing models mean that ticket costs can change based on real-time demand. Fans looking for the best value should monitor ticket marketplaces and consider purchasing multi-game packages if available, which can sometimes offer a slight discount compared to single-game tickets. Fan Challenges and Solutions for Ticket Purchasing
Purchasing MLB World Series tickets can present several challenges for fans. One of the most significant is the sheer demand, which often leads to tickets selling out within minutes of becoming available, especially for popular teams or high-stakes games. This scarcity drives up prices on the secondary market, making tickets prohibitively expensive for many. Another challenge is the risk of counterfeit tickets, a concern for any major event. Fans may also struggle with navigating complex ticketing platforms or understanding variable pricing structures. To overcome these challenges for the 2025 MLB season, fans can adopt several strategies. Firstly, stay informed about official ticket release dates and times through MLB and team official channels. Setting up alerts and having accounts pre-registered on ticketing platforms can save crucial seconds. Secondly, consider purchasing tickets from reputable secondary marketplaces that offer buyer protection and ticket verification services. This can mitigate the risk of receiving fraudulent tickets. For those concerned about high prices, exploring less conventional seating sections or considering weekday games (if applicable to the series schedule) might offer more affordable options. Finally, familiarize yourself with mobile ticketing technology, as most venues now rely on digital tickets for entry, ensuring a smooth and secure process on game day.

Ticket Verification and Secure Purchasing for the World Series
When purchasing MLB World Series tickets, especially on the secondary market, ensuring the authenticity of your tickets is paramount. Many reputable ticketing platforms now offer robust verification processes. These can include digital ticket scanning upon entry, barcode verification, and even fan insurance that protects against fraudulent tickets. For the 2025 season, it's advisable to stick to well-established resale sites that have a proven track record of secure transactions and offer guarantees. Always be wary of deals that seem too good to be true, as they often are. Understanding the official refund policies and transfer protocols for tickets is also crucial. By prioritizing secure purchasing methods and thorough verification, fans can significantly reduce the risk of encountering counterfeit tickets and ensure they have a legitimate entry to the most exciting event in baseball.
